derrrrrrr. no.

rarely will a clown host in a Condilactus gigatica )although Tinysreef swears to the contrary:P)

 

well perhaps the afore mentioned is possible,

but I'd think it more to be a Heteractis crispa or "leathery" Sea Anemone.

they have pink tips and a red bassal foot. Chances are it may be bleached out.

I have had a maroon clown, a gold striped maroon, 2 percs, and a saddel back (of corse not in the same tanks except the percs) ALL of which too Condylactus as hosts. if you put the anenome and the clowns in a big net and hang it on the edge of the aquarium with them in the water for several hours - when released, and the anenome finds a spot it likes, the clown automatically goes right to the anenome.
